BEST. PUMP. EVER.,
I can’t say enough good things about this pump.
I have used it with 4 children now, and it does work wonders. I EXCLUSIVELY pump, so that should be noted as you read this review.
Pros:
-Way more suction than any other pump I have used. I have tried both electric and manual pumps, and I have gotten the most milk with this one than even the electrics. I usually get the most milk in the morning, and by the time my babies were about 3 months old, I was getting 32 ounces at my first morning pump, with each pumping after that producing about 12-16 ounces during the day. I was pumping about 6 times a day on average at that point.
-I love the portability of the pump….easy to just put it in your [oversized] purse or diaper bag. Better to me than carrying around a big bulky electric unit and pump.
-It’s very easy to use; I have used it both with the petal insert and without.
Cons:
-the squeakiness. I have found though (took me 3 kids to figure out a GOOD solution) that adding just a dab of Vaseline does an amazing job of eliminating the squeak. Just put a small amount right where the parts are squeaking (in the middle of the pump where the handle attaches to the suction piece). Other than that, it’s very quiet (although EVERY pump is going to make some amount of noise…thankfully you don’t get the “whaahhhh whhhhhhho” sound like with an electric).
- the many parts. Granted most pumps have several parts to clean, this pump does feel like you are working on a small project when putting it all back together. That being said, I will admit that I didn’t take it all apart EVERY time I cleaned it. Usually just some very hot, slightly soapy water worked out (with the occasional steam sterilization and taking it apart to clean).
- the STRONG suction (which could also be seen as a “pro”)… You either should use a small amount of nipple cream beforehand or just adjust how much you squeeze the handle. I definitely got used to it over time, and still preferred the strong suction to not enough suction!
Also, if you’re getting some milk under the petal insert (which did happen to me from time to time), just remove the petal insert. I got just as much milk without it.
I really do love this pump. It’s been the source of many many bags of stored breast milk and was a life-saver when my daughter wouldn’t latch. I don’t think I would have exclusively pumped for so long if it weren’t for this pump!
I highly recommend!

|Best manual pump!,
I have tried 4 different manual pumps and by far AVENT makes the most comfortable pump there is.
Comfort and the strength of suction is key when pumping to yield the most “liquid gold”.
I also have an electric one which I bought that is great, but this one stayed in the nursery and was great for relieving engorgement in the middle of the night, or when I need a little more out than the baby took. I could also use it while walking around the house which I couldn’t do with my electric one. It was pretty powerful too – could get a whole feeding in a few minutes. It’s easy to use with one hand, so I can nurse my daughter on one side and pump the other side. Lastly, it’s super easy to clean as are the bottles because there are far less parts.
